This group of five friends had tried to steal cars on several occasions,but unsuccessfully. On January 20,they tried again,and ended up murdering a 17-year-old.
The Gurgaon police have arrested five persons for allegedly murdering Abhishek,from Sankho village in Bahadurgarh,and burning his body. To cover their trail,they threw the victims clothes in a pond and abandoned the vehicle in Sonepat,after making alterations in its number plate,police said.
The accused have been identified as Ashwini,Pankaj,Praveen,Rupesh and Navin.
According to police,the five waylaid Abhisheks Santro car while he was passing through the national highway in Bahadurgarh. After pushing him to the side,they commandeered the vehicle and drove it down the road. Their plan,however,went haywire when the victim recognised Ashwini,a local resident. Scared that he may identify them,Naveen and Pankaj allegedly shot him twice.
Later,they drove to Daryapur in Delhi and,after finding a vacant site,they burnt his body. They threw Abhisheks clothes and belongings in a nearby pond, said DCP (East) Maheshwar Dayal.
Though police found the charred body,they kept it in the mortuary because it could not be immediately identified. Meanwhile,as Abhishek remained missing,villagers protested and demanded that police investigate his disappearance.
Haryana DGP R S Dalal ordered an inquiry into the incident,and transferred the case to the Crime Branch. Special teams were constituted to crack the case.
The case was solved when the gang decided to rob another vehicle near Palam Vihar on Thursday. Acting on a tip-off,police arrested the five. They were later found to be involved in Abhisheks murder. Based on information procured from them,police also found the Santro car.
Abhishek,an only child,was studying at a technical college in Bahadurgarh.
